data PennPOS
  = CC -- ^ Coordinating conjunction
  | CD -- ^ Cardinal number
  | DT -- ^ Determiner
  | EX -- ^ Existential *there*
  | FW -- ^ Foreign word
  | IN -- ^ Preposition or subordinating conjunction
  | JJ -- ^ Adjective
  | JJR -- ^ Adjective, comparative
  | JJS -- ^ Adjective, superlative
  | LS -- ^ List item marker
  | MD -- ^ Modal
  | NN -- ^ Noun, singular or mass
  | NNS -- ^ Noun, plural
  | NNP -- ^ Proper noun, singular
  | NNPS -- ^ Proper noun, plural
  | PDT -- ^ Predeterminer
  | POS -- ^ Possessive ending
  | PRP -- ^ Personal pronoun
  | PRPDollar -- ^ Possessive pronoun
  | RB -- ^ Adverb
  | RBR -- ^ Adverb, comparative
  | RBS -- ^ Adverb, superlative
  | RP -- ^ Particle
  | SYM -- ^ Symbol
  | TO -- ^ *to*
  | UH -- ^ Interjection
  | VB -- ^ Verb, base form
  | VBD -- ^ Verb, past tense
  | VBG -- ^ Verb, gerund or present participle
  | VBN -- ^ Verb, past participle
  | VBP -- ^ Verb, non-3rd person singular present
  | VBZ -- ^ Verb, 3rd person singular present
  | WDT -- ^ Wh-determiner
  | WP -- ^ Wh-pronoun
  | WPDollar -- ^ Possessive wh-pronoun
  | WRB -- ^ Wh-adverb
  | LRB -- ^ "-LRB-"? No idea what's this
  | RRB -- ^ "-RRB-"? No idea what's this
  | PosPunctuation -- ^ anyOf ".:,''$#$,", sometimes few together
  deriving (Show, Eq, Generic)

instance Store.Store PennPOS

instance FromJSON PennPOS where
  parseJSON (J.String "WP$") = pure WPDollar
  parseJSON (J.String "PRP$") = pure PRPDollar
  parseJSON (J.String "-LRB-") = pure LRB
  parseJSON (J.String "-RRB-") = pure RRB
  parseJSON x = J.genericParseJSON jsonOpts x <|> parsePunctuation x
    where
      parsePunctuation (J.String _) = pure PosPunctuation
      parsePunctuation _ = fail "Expecting POS to be a String"

instance ToJSON PennPOS where
  toJSON WPDollar = J.String "WP$"
  toJSON PRPDollar = J.String "PRP$"
  toJSON PosPunctuation = J.String "."
  toJSON LRB = J.String "-LRB-"
  toJSON RRB = J.String "-RRB-"
  toJSON x = J.genericToJSON jsonOpts x

-- | Additional options
data LaunchOptions = LaunchOptions
  { cacheDb :: Maybe FilePath -- ^ Optional path to a RocksDB file which will be used as a cache
  , memSizeMb :: Int -- ^ The "-Xmx" Java parameter
  , chunkSize :: Int -- ^ Number of elements by which to split the input. Good for caching upon a failure
  , numWorkers :: Int -- ^ Number of CoreNLP workers to launch in parallel
  } deriving (Show, Eq)

instance Default LaunchOptions where
  def = LaunchOptions Nothing 8096 1000 2

-- | Got this from https:\/\/stackoverflow.com\/questions\/29155068\/running-parallel-url-downloads-with-a-worker-pool-in-haskell
traverseThrottled :: Traversable t => Int -> (a -> IO b) -> t a -> IO (t b)
traverseThrottled concLevel action taskContainer = do
  sem <- newQSem concLevel
  let throttledAction = bracket_ (waitQSem sem) (signalQSem sem) . action
  runConcurrently (traverse (Concurrently . throttledAction) taskContainer)

-- | Launch CoreNLP with your inputs. This function will put every
-- piece of 'Text' in a separate file, launch CoreNLP subprocess, and
-- parse the results
launchCoreNLP ::
     FilePath -- ^ Path to the directory where you extracted the CoreNLP project
  -> LaunchOptions
  -> [Text] -- ^ List of inputs
  -> IO [ParsedDocument] -- ^ List of parsed results
launchCoreNLP fp' LaunchOptions {..} texts' = do
  let fp = ensureEndSlash fp'
  case cacheDb of
    Nothing -> go Nothing fp texts'
    Just cacheFp ->
      bracket
        (Rocks.open cacheFp def {Rocks.createIfMissing = True})
        Rocks.close
        (\db -> go (Just db) fp texts')
  where
    ensureEndSlash :: String -> String
    ensureEndSlash t =
      if t !! (Prelude.length t - 1) == '/'
        then t
        else t <> "/"
    go :: Maybe Rocks.DB -> FilePath -> [Text] -> IO [ParsedDocument]
    go mcacheDb fp texts'' = do
      withSystemTempDirectory "corenlp-parser" $ \tempDir ->
        withCurrentDirectory tempDir $ do
          (cachedDocs, texts) <- getCachedDocs mcacheDb texts''
          Prelude.putStrLn $
            "Got documents out of cache: " ++ show (Prelude.length cachedDocs)
          res <-
            Prelude.concat <$>
            traverseThrottled
              numWorkers
              (goByChunk tempDir mcacheDb fp)
              (zip ([1 ..] :: [Integer]) (chunksOf chunkSize texts))
          return (cachedDocs ++ res)
    goByChunk tempDir mcacheDb fp (chunkId, texts) = do
      Prelude.putStrLn "> goByChunk started"
      if Prelude.length texts <= 0
        then return []
        else do
          Prelude.putStrLn $ "Temp dir used is: " <> tempDir
          tmpFileNames <-
            forM (zip [1 ..] texts) $ \(i :: Integer, txt) -> do
              let fname = "text-" ++ show chunkId ++ "-" ++ show i ++ ".txt"
              T.writeFile (tempDir ++ "/" ++ fname) txt
              return fname
          withSystemTempFile "filelist.txt" $ \filelistTxt hfilelistTxt -> do
            Prelude.putStrLn $ "Filelist.txt: " ++ show filelistTxt
            let filesList =
                  T.unlines
                    (map (\x -> S.toText (tempDir <> "/" <> x)) tmpFileNames)
            T.hPutStrLn hfilelistTxt (T.strip filesList)
            hFlush hfilelistTxt
            let cmd =
                  "java --add-modules java.se.ee -cp \"" ++
                  fp ++
                  "*\" -Xmx" ++
                  show memSizeMb ++
                  "m edu.stanford.nlp.pipeline.StanfordCoreNLP -annotators tokenize,ssplit,pos,lemma,ner,parse,dcoref -outputFormat json -filelist " <>
                  filelistTxt
            Prelude.putStrLn $ "Running a command: " ++ cmd
            let spec = shell cmd
            (_, _, _, processHandle) <- createProcess spec
            code <- waitForProcess processHandle
            when (code /= ExitSuccess) (error (show code))
            let tmpFileNamesJson = map (<> ".json") tmpFileNames
            results <- forM tmpFileNamesJson $ \fname -> T.readFile fname
            rv <- extractSuccessDocs (zip texts (map parseJsonDoc results))
            cacheResults mcacheDb rv
            return rv
    getCachedDocs :: Maybe Rocks.DB -> [Text] -> IO ([ParsedDocument], [Text])
    getCachedDocs Nothing texts = return ([], texts)
    getCachedDocs (Just rocks) texts = do
      (rv :: [Either ParsedDocument Text]) <-
        forM texts $ \t -> do
          res <- Rocks.get rocks def (hash t)
          case res of
            Nothing -> return (Right t)
            Just bs ->
              case Store.decode bs of
                Left _e -> return (Right t)
                Right x -> return (Left x)
      return (partitionEithers rv)
    cacheResults Nothing _ = return ()
    cacheResults (Just rocks) results = do
      let batch = map resultToOp results
      Rocks.write rocks def batch
      return ()
    resultToOp pd@ParsedDocument {..} =
      Rocks.Put (hash origText) (Store.encode pd)
    hash t =
      S.fromString
        (show
           (Crypto.hash (S.toStrictByteString t) :: Crypto.Digest Crypto.SHA256))
